Overview: Train from Coventry to Poole
Trains from Coventry to Poole run on average 5 times per day, taking around 2h 59m. Cheap train tickets for this journey start at £56 but you can travel from only £19 by coach.
The earliest train runs at 05:00, the last at 21:26. The fastest train covers the 191 km distance in 3h 12m.
